This fall, the Supreme Court granted a case about an outrageous injustice perpetrated against a Michigan family—and Pacific Legal Foundation has joined the case as co-counsel.

On December 17, join us for an online discussion about upcoming Supreme Court case Pung v. Isabella County. Join lead counsel, Phil Ellison, as well as PLF’s Larry Salzman and Christina Martin as they go through the shocking facts of the case: how the Pung family lost their home because a tax assessor claimed they didn’t file the right paperwork; how the County wrongly evicted the family; and how the home was auctioned off in a fire sale for a fraction of its value.

PLF won a landmark victory at the Supreme Court in 2023’s Tyler v. Hennepin County, which held the government may not take more than is owed in tax foreclosures. Now, in Pung, PLF is going back to the Supreme Court to hold the government accountable.
